Common Problems & Issues
While the 2023 Honda Jazz is generally reliable, owners have reported certain common issues.
- Rear wiper motor failure at high mileage
- Infotainment Bluetooth pairing drops
- Road noise intrusion from wheel wells
- Clutch feel inconsistency in manual variants
Most of these issues are minor and can be addressed through regular maintenance and prompt attention to any symptoms.
